ChartGraphics Třída
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Poskytuje řadu převodních funkcí a zpřístupňuje objekt GDI+ Graphics .
public ref class ChartGraphics : System::Web::UI::DataVisualization::Charting::ChartElement
public class ChartGraphics : System.Web.UI.DataVisualization.Charting.ChartElement
type ChartGraphics = class
inherit ChartElement
Public Class ChartGraphics
Inherits ChartElement
- Dědičnost
Poznámky
Tato třída poskytuje řadu převodních funkcí a také zveřejňuje objekt GDI+ Graphics . Všimněte si, že při vykreslování ve formátu SVG (Scalable Vector Graphics) nebude použití objektu Graphics pro vlastní výkres součástí dokumentu SVG.
Všimněte si také, že ve výchozím nastavení Graphics funkce obvykle přebírají absolutní souřadnice. Proto by metody převodu této třídy měly být užitečné, pokud provádíte operace kreslení.
Objekt ChartGraphics je vystaven ve ChartGraphics vlastnosti ChartPaintEventArgs třídy , což usnadňuje provádění vlastního kreslení v PrePaint událostech a PostPaint .
Důležité
Pokud jsou provedeny významné změny výchozího chování objektu Graphics , obrázek grafu a jeho přidružené prvky mohou být vykresleny chybně. Může se například změnit umístění. Důrazně doporučujeme, abyste se seznámili s rozhraním GDI+ před provedením jakýchkoli významných změn vlastností objektu Graphics .
Vlastnosti
Graphics |
Získá nebo nastaví GDI + Graphics objekt, který lze použít pro účely kreslení. |
Tag |
Získá nebo nastaví objekt přidružený k tomuto prvku grafu. (Zděděno od ChartElement) |
Metody
Dispose() |
Uvolní prostředky používané nástrojem ChartElement. (Zděděno od ChartElement) |
Dispose(Boolean) |
Uvolní nespravované a volitelně i spravované prostředky. |
Equals(Object) |
Určuje, zda se zadaná Object hodnota rovná aktuální ChartElementhodnotě . (Zděděno od ChartElement) |
GetAbsolutePoint(PointF) |
PointF Vezme objekt a převede jeho relativní souřadnice na absolutní souřadnice. |
GetAbsoluteRectangle(RectangleF) |
RectangleF Vezme objekt a převede jeho relativní souřadnice na absolutní souřadnice. |
GetAbsoluteSize(SizeF) |
SizeF Vezme objekt, který používá relativní souřadnice a vrátí SizeF objekt, který používá absolutní souřadnice. |
GetHashCode() |
Vrátí funkci hash pro konkrétní typ. (Zděděno od ChartElement) |
GetPositionFromAxis(String, AxisName, Double) |
Vezme hodnotu dané osy pro zadanou osu a vrátí relativní pixelovou hodnotu. |
GetRelativePoint(PointF) |
PointF Přebírá objekt, který používá absolutní souřadnice a vrací PointF objekt, který používá relativní souřadnice. |
GetRelativeRectangle(RectangleF) |
RectangleF Přebírá strukturu, která používá absolutní souřadnice a vrací RectangleF objekt, který používá relativní souřadnice. |
GetRelativeSize(SizeF) |
SizeF Vezme objekt v absolutních souřadnicích a vrátí SizeF objekt, který používá relativní souřadnice. |
GetType() |
Type Získá z aktuální instance. (Zděděno od Object) |
MemberwiseClone() |
Vytvoří mělkou kopii aktuálního Objectsouboru . (Zděděno od Object) |
ToString() |
Vrátí řetězec, který představuje aktuální Objecthodnotu . (Zděděno od ChartElement) |